### Runbook: BounceBroom — Account Recovery

If the BounceBroom email bounce processor loses access to its service account, do not create a new one. First, pause the intake queue so bounces buffer safely. Then open the recovery console and select the BounceBroom principal. Verification requires approval from the on-call lead. Once approved, the console prompts for the stored recovery credentials; enter the passphrase that appears directly below this paragraph.

recovery phrase for fahof-kahap: holion-gormir-jorix-istix-briwyn-sorael

MEMO — Branch Managers

Re: Fernhollow franchise agreement.

Signing expected Friday. Fernhollow Trading takes the three coastal territories under our Lanternmark brand. Royalty structure unchanged. Training obligations fall to regional leads; schedules out next week. Do not discuss terms externally until the joint announcement. Direct questions to Operations. Rationale for the timing is set out below.

board note of bawep-tajef: Queniusek Systems plans to raise the Quenvan list price by 53.1 percent in March. The pricing group signed off on a budget of $176.4 million for Project Drueth. The renewal with Casionix Partners closes at $142.5 million a year, 8.3 percent below the last contract. Project Fraax slips by six weeks because of the tooling delay.

Document Transport — Print Shop Master Copies

Quick guide for moving master copies to Bramblehurst Print Co. These are the only originals, so treat the run like a valuables transfer, not a regular parcel drop. Use the red tamper-evident envelopes from the supply shelf, log the seal number in the transport book, and never combine the run with general mail. The masters go directly to the press supervisor, nobody else. On arrival, the courier must follow the hand-over instruction stated below.

drop instructions, kajep-tageg: the kasvan casdor courier leaves the quenvan quenox druox ledger at gate 4316 under passcode 799004